×

由LED组成的光立方3D显示器设计资料说明

消耗积分:10 | 格式:doc | 大小:1.12 MB | 2020-05-03

kopion

分享资料个

  3Dcube8(光立方) 是一个由LED组成的3D显示器,是一个集实际型 、经济型、性价比高的艺术品, 它不仅仅局限于装饰,更是能够帮助更好的学习 c语言实际应用、满足单片机爱好者对单片机的研究的个好工具。

  3Dcube8有多种规格,常见的有单色4*4*4、单色8*8*8、RGB全彩光立方等。其中前者是这之中最简单的,制作难度和成本最高的是采用RGB的全彩光立方,综合成本和自身能力的考虑,选择制作单色8*8*8作为自己的课题。

  方案比较与选择

  光立方的显示屏是由8片8*8的led点阵屏组成,通常的搭建方案有两种,层共阳与层共阴。

  两种方案实际操作没有太大区别,为了后期的成品效果外观美观,在这里我们选择层共阳。

  Led的选择:市面上有很多种发光二极管,按形状分方形和圆形草帽状、按效果又有高亮雾面等区别。考虑到美观和降低制作难度,我们选择了3mm长脚高亮雾面草帽型发光二级管,长脚的最大优势就是可以作为支架,省时省力。

  驱动方式利用人眼视觉暂留特性,利用逐层扫描的方式,来达到显示各种图案的目的。常见的coms锁存器(cmos发热低,优先选择)有74hc573和74hc595,前者为并入,后者串入。因为不需要光立方的级联设计,所以采用573锁存器。

  主控芯片选择较多,有常见的AVR、STC、ARDUINO 等。根据之前学过的课程,我们决定采用stc系列的STC89c5A60S2增强型单片机作为主控芯片。之所以不选89C52等芯片,不是因为他们的运算速度不够,主要原因是它们的片上flash太小,难以满足需求,其次是因为自己有闲置的STC89C5A60S2,片上内存大,运算速度1T,即充分利用资源节省成本,又可以实现所需要的功能需求。

  最后就是附属配件 usb转ttl串口的stc下载线。

  ,选择采用cp2102作为usb转串口芯片方案,下载STC单片机完胜PL2303方案,最高下载速度可达115200波特率。

  三:电路设计

  实验前准备

  实验环境:protues7.7,keil4.0,STC-ISPv4.80

  实验工具:恒温电烙铁,无铅锡丝,尖嘴钳,万用版,万能表等。

  主要分为三个模块分别是主控模块 驱动模块 显示模块

  控制模块——单片机最小系统

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

评论(1)
发评论
万般努力只为出人头地w 2020-12-15
0 回复 举报
楼主好厉害 收起回复

下载排行榜

全部1条评论

快来发表一下你的评论吧 !